Transaction 20cf59bff26deef0f19699ab6f444d65f984baa2d7663b65e64993236e3f6155
1 Input
1 Output
-
20cf59bff26deef0f19699ab6f444d65f984baa2d7663b65e64993236e3f6155:0
- value
- 144218736
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ef540523245846784b1d53da504d3a5c3810b0b6
- address
- bc1qaa2q2geytpr8sjca20d9qnf6tsuppv9kmgp6rq